Notes
Recording Period: Feb 1975
Label: Columbia Records
Miles Davis, Trumpet, Organ
Sonny Fortune, Soprano Saxophone, Flute
Pete Cosey, Electric Guitar, Percussion, Synth
Reggie Lucas, Electric Guitar
Michael Henderson, Electric Bass
Al Foster, Drums
James Mtume, Percussion
Teo Macero, Producer
Tomoo Suzuki, Engineer

referencing Pangaea (2×LP, Album, Reissue) 28AP 2169~70
Still by far the best vinyl issue.
Purchased 1981 Japanese reissues of Agharta and Pangaea and both sound amazing.
Both have the original mix which so far have not been reissued on vinyl.
Beware of other versions as most if not all were terribly remixed. -

referencing Pangaea (2×LP, Album) SOPZ 96~97
While Agharta might be the stronger of the two performances from Festival Hall, Pangaea is actually becoming more of a favorite for me. Case in point: the ending of Gondwana (Part II) on Pangaea concludes with some remarkably sensitive interplay between Cosey, Lucas, Mtume, and Foster, with Miles occasionally providing some complimentary organ. Paul Tingen argues that this last track "dissolves into entropy again, leaving Cosey alone on Synthi A to play out the concert," but to me it just sounds pleasant, emotional, and, at the very conclusion, pretty damn avant-garde. Also, the sound quality of the 1975 Japanese issue of Pangaea actually sounds cleaner to me than the '75 edition of Agharta--not sure why--with great separation between the instruments and, as wplj mentioned below, an "airy feeling." Worth it.
